The Wisconsin Restaurant Association and its over 7,000 members are committed
to food safety. We believe that everyone in our industry, no matter what
their position, is a key player in keeping the food we serve safe.
Each September, restaurant and food service professionals across the
country demonstrate their commitment to food safety by spreading the message
throughout their establishments and communities.
Created by the National Restaurant Association Educational Foundation's
International Food Safety Council, this annual food safety campaign strives
to: build awareness of the restaurant and foodservice industry's commitment
to serving safe food, heighten awareness about the importance of food
safety education and encourage additional food safety training for all
industry employees.

Founded in 1987, the WRA Education Foundation is one
of the largest state restaurant association foundations in the U.S. It
strives to create a promising future for the foodservice industry by raising
awareness of foodservice as a professional career path, providing ongoing
training and education for foodservice professionals and serving as a
state leader on food safety and sanitation.
